ooey-gooey peanut butter brownies

- .3/4 cup fat-free sweetened condensed milk, divided
- 1/4 cup butter or stick margarine, melted and cooled
- 1/4 cup fat-free milk $
- 1 (18.25-ounce) package devil's food cake mix
- 1 large egg white, lightly beaten $
- Cooking spray
- 1 (7-ounce) jar marshmallow creme (about 1 3/4 cups)
- 1/2 cup peanut butter morsels

Preparation
Step 1
Preheat oven to 350°.
Combine 1/4 cup condensed milk, butter, and next 3 ingredients (butter through egg white) in a bowl (batter will be very stiff). Coat bottom of a 13 x 9-inch baking pan with cooking spray. Press two-thirds of batter into prepared pan using floured hands; pat evenly (layer will be thin).
Bake at 350° for 10 minutes. Combine 1/2 cup condensed milk and marshmallow creme in a bowl; stir in morsels. Spread marshmallow mixture evenly over brownie layer. Carefully drop remaining batter by spoonfuls over marshmallow mixture. Bake at 350° for 30 minutes. Cool completely in pan on a wire rack.
Nutritional Information
Amount per serving
Calories: 176
Calories from fat: 25%
Fat: 5g
Saturated fat: 2.1g
Monounsaturated fat: 1.6g
Polyunsaturated fat: 1.1g
Protein: 2.6g
Carbohydrate: 29.9g
Fiber: 0.8g
Cholesterol: 6mg
Iron: 0.8mg
Sodium: 212mg
Calcium: 30mg
